This paper aims to study the experimental and analytical behaviour of cold-formed steel (CFS) T-joint members with or without external ring stiff eners under combined axial compression and bending. The parameters varied in the study include the type of T-joints (with and without ring stiff eners), spacing of the stiff eners (100 mm and 200 mm from the central axis of the T-Joint), and thickness of the ring stiff eners (4 mm and 6 mm). The load–defl ection and load-strain behaviour were studied by measuring the overall defl ection of the T-joints and strain using dial gauges and strain indicators, respectively. The load-carrying capacity of the T-joints with external ring stiff eners was compared, and the results of a numerical investigation showed good agreement. An extensive parametric study was carried out for diff erent geometric parameters of the ring stiff ener, chord, and brace member using the FE model to obtain the ultimate strength of the stiff ened T-joints, and strength was also compared and obtained using the published equation. From the results of this investigation, it was found that the T-joints with external ring stiff eners can resist more strength and deformation when compared to the T-joints without external ring stiff eners.
